Released February 1st, 2016, 'Hollow Creek' stars Steve Daron, Guisela Moro, Burt Reynolds, David Ausem The movie has a runtime of about 1 hr 56 min, and received a user score of 45 (out of 100) on TMDb, which collated reviews from 15 top users.
Want to know what the movie's about? Here's the plot: "Trying to find inspiration for his next horror novel Blake retreats to the Appalachian Mountains with his mistress Angelica Upon arrival they learn about the case of several missing boys in the area When Angelica follows a lead to one of the missing boys and disappears Blake becomes a prime suspect"
